#!/usr/bin/env bash
DOMAIN=''
INSTALL=''
REMOVE=''
CONT_NAME='litespeed'
CERT_DIR='./certs'
EPACE=' '
echow(){
FLAG=${1}
shift
echo -e "\033[1m${EPACE}${FLAG}\033[0m${@}"
}
help_message(){
echo -e "\033[1mUSAGE\033[0m"
echo "${EPACE}mkcert.sh [OPTIONS]"
echo ""
echo -e "\033[1mOPTIONS\033[0m"
echow '-D, --domain [DOMAIN_NAME]'
echo "${EPACE}${EPACE}Example: mkcert.sh --domain example.test"
echo "${EPACE}${EPACE}Will create certificate for example.test and www.example.test"
echow '-I, --install'
echo "${EPACE}${EPACE}Install mkcert on Windows (requires Chocolatey)"
echow '-R, --remove'
echo "${EPACE}${EPACE}Remove certificate for a specific domain"
echow '-H, --help'
echo "${EPACE}${EPACE}Display help and exit"
exit 0
}
check_input(){
if [ -z "${1}" ]; then
help_message
fi
}
domain_filter(){
if [ -z "${1}" ]; then
echo "[X] Domain name is required!"
exit 1
fi
DOMAIN="${1}"
DOMAIN="${DOMAIN#http://}"
DOMAIN="${DOMAIN#https://}"
DOMAIN="${DOMAIN#ftp://}"
DOMAIN="${DOMAIN%%/*}"
}
www_domain(){
CHECK_WWW=$(echo ${1} | cut -c1-4)
if [[ ${CHECK_WWW} == www. ]] ; then
DOMAIN=$(echo ${1} | cut -c 5-)
else
DOMAIN=${1}
fi
WWW_DOMAIN="www.${DOMAIN}"
}
check_mkcert(){
echo '[Start] Checking mkcert installation'
# Try .exe first (for WSL/Windows)
if command -v mkcert.exe >/dev/null 2>&1; then
MKCERT_CMD="mkcert.exe"
echo -e "[O] mkcert is installed (using: mkcert.exe)"
elif command -v mkcert >/dev/null 2>&1; then
MKCERT_CMD="mkcert"
echo -e "[O] mkcert is installed (using: mkcert)"
else
echo "[X] mkcert is not installed!"
echo "[!] Please run: ./bin/mkcert.sh --install"
echo "[!] Or install manually: choco install mkcert"
exit 1
fi
echo '[End] Checking mkcert'
}
install_mkcert(){
echo '[Start] Installing mkcert'
# Try Windows executable first (for WSL/Git Bash)
choco.exe --version > /dev/null 2>&1
CHOCO_CHECK=$?
# If .exe doesn't work, try without extension
if [ ${CHOCO_CHECK} != 0 ]; then
choco --version > /dev/null 2>&1
CHOCO_CHECK=$?
fi
if [ ${CHOCO_CHECK} != 0 ]; then
echo "[X] Chocolatey is not installed or not in PATH!"
echo "[!] Please install Chocolatey first: https://chocolatey.org/install"
echo "[!] After installation, restart your terminal"
exit 1
fi
echo "[O] Chocolatey is installed"
# Check if mkcert already installed (try .exe first for WSL)
mkcert.exe -version > /dev/null 2>&1
MKCERT_CHECK=$?
if [ ${MKCERT_CHECK} != 0 ]; then
mkcert -version > /dev/null 2>&1
MKCERT_CHECK=$?
fi
if [ ${MKCERT_CHECK} = 0 ]; then
echo "[!] mkcert is already installed"
MKCERT_VERSION=$(mkcert.exe -version 2>&1 || mkcert -version 2>&1 | head -n 1)
echo "[!] Version: ${MKCERT_VERSION}"
echo "[!] Running mkcert -install to ensure local CA is configured..."
mkcert.exe -install || mkcert -install
echo '[End] Installing mkcert'
return 0
fi
echo "[!] Installing mkcert via Chocolatey..."
choco.exe install mkcert -y || choco install mkcert -y
if [ ${?} = 0 ]; then
echo -e "[O] mkcert installed successfully"
echo "[!] Running mkcert -install to create local CA..."
mkcert.exe -install || mkcert -install
echo '[End] Installing mkcert'
else
echo "[X] Failed to install mkcert"
exit 1
fi
}
create_cert_dir(){
if [ ! -d "${CERT_DIR}" ]; then
echo "[!] Creating certificate directory: ${CERT_DIR}"
mkdir -p "${CERT_DIR}"
fi
}
generate_cert(){
echo '[Start] Generating SSL certificate'
domain_filter "${DOMAIN}"
www_domain "${DOMAIN}"
create_cert_dir
cd "${CERT_DIR}"
echo -e "[!] Generating certificate for: \033[32m${DOMAIN}\033[0m and \033[32m${WWW_DOMAIN}\033[0m"
# Use the detected mkcert command
${MKCERT_CMD} "${DOMAIN}" "${WWW_DOMAIN}"
if [ ${?} = 0 ]; then
echo -e "[O] Certificate generated successfully"
# Rename files to standard format
CERT_FILE="${DOMAIN}+1.pem"
KEY_FILE="${DOMAIN}+1-key.pem"
if [ -f "${CERT_FILE}" ] && [ -f "${KEY_FILE}" ]; then
echo "[!] Certificate files:"
echo "${EPACE}Cert: ${CERT_DIR}/${CERT_FILE}"
echo "${EPACE}Key: ${CERT_DIR}/${KEY_FILE}"
fi
else
echo "[X] Failed to generate certificate"
exit 1
fi
cd - > /dev/null
echo '[End] Generating SSL certificate'
}
configure_litespeed(){
echo '[Start] Configuring OpenLiteSpeed'
CERT_FILE="${DOMAIN}+1.pem"
KEY_FILE="${DOMAIN}+1-key.pem"
# Check if certificate files exist
if [ ! -f "${CERT_DIR}/${CERT_FILE}" ] || [ ! -f "${CERT_DIR}/${KEY_FILE}" ]; then
echo "[X] Certificate files not found!"
exit 1
fi
echo "[!] Configuring SSL for domain: ${DOMAIN}"
LSWS_CONF_DIR="/usr/local/lsws/conf"
HTTPD_CONF="${LSWS_CONF_DIR}/httpd_config.conf"
# Copy certificates to container
docker compose cp "${CERT_DIR}/${CERT_FILE}" ${CONT_NAME}:${LSWS_CONF_DIR}/cert/
docker compose cp "${CERT_DIR}/${KEY_FILE}" ${CONT_NAME}:${LSWS_CONF_DIR}/cert/
echo "[O] Certificates copied to container"
# Backup config
docker compose exec -T ${CONT_NAME} bash -c "cp ${HTTPD_CONF} ${HTTPD_CONF}.backup.\$(date +%Y%m%d_%H%M%S)"
echo "[O] Config backed up"
# Kiểm tra xem đã có SSL Listener chưa
HAS_SSL=$(docker compose exec -T ${CONT_NAME} bash -c "grep -c 'listener Default HTTPS' ${HTTPD_CONF}" | tr -d '\r')
if [ "${HAS_SSL}" = "0" ]; then
echo '[!] Creating new SSL Listener...'
# Tạo SSL listener mới
docker compose exec -T ${CONT_NAME} bash -c "cat >> ${HTTPD_CONF} <<'LISTENER_EOF'
listener Default HTTPS {
address *:443
secure 1
keyFile ${LSWS_CONF_DIR}/cert/${KEY_FILE}
certFile ${LSWS_CONF_DIR}/cert/${CERT_FILE}
certChain 1
sslProtocol 24
enableSpdy 15
map ${DOMAIN} ${DOMAIN}
}
LISTENER_EOF
"
echo '[O] SSL Listener created'
else
echo '[!] SSL Listener exists, updating...'
# Cập nhật cert paths
docker compose exec -T ${CONT_NAME} bash -c "
sed -i '/listener Default HTTPS/,/^}/s|keyFile.*| keyFile ${LSWS_CONF_DIR}/cert/${KEY_FILE}|' ${HTTPD_CONF}
sed -i '/listener Default HTTPS/,/^}/s|certFile.*| certFile ${LSWS_CONF_DIR}/cert/${CERT_FILE}|' ${HTTPD_CONF}
"
echo '[O] Certificate paths updated'
# Kiểm tra xem domain đã được map chưa
HAS_MAPPING=$(docker compose exec -T ${CONT_NAME} bash -c "grep -A 15 'listener Default HTTPS' ${HTTPD_CONF} | grep -c 'map.*${DOMAIN}'" | tr -d '\r')
if [ "${HAS_MAPPING}" = "0" ]; then
# Thêm mapping
docker compose exec -T ${CONT_NAME} bash -c "
sed -i '/listener Default HTTPS/,/^}/ {
/^}/i\ map ${DOMAIN} ${DOMAIN}
}' ${HTTPD_CONF}
"
echo '[O] Domain mapping added to SSL Listener'
else
echo '[!] Domain mapping already exists'
fi
fi
echo ""
echo "[!] Current SSL Listener configuration:"
docker compose exec -T ${CONT_NAME} bash -c "grep -A 15 'listener Default HTTPS' ${HTTPD_CONF}"
echo ""
if [ ${?} = 0 ]; then
echo -e "[O] SSL configured for: \033[32m${DOMAIN}\033[0m"
echo "[!] Restarting OpenLiteSpeed..."
lsws_restart
else
echo "[X] Failed to configure SSL"
exit 1
fi
echo '[End] Configuring OpenLiteSpeed'
}
lsws_restart(){
docker compose exec ${CONT_NAME} su -c '/usr/local/lsws/bin/lswsctrl restart >/dev/null'
if [ ${?} = 0 ]; then
echo -e "[O] OpenLiteSpeed restarted successfully"
else
echo "[X] Failed to restart OpenLiteSpeed"
fi
}
remove_cert(){
echo '[Start] Removing SSL certificate'
domain_filter "${DOMAIN}"
CERT_FILE="${DOMAIN}+1.pem"
KEY_FILE="${DOMAIN}+1-key.pem"
if [ -f "${CERT_DIR}/${CERT_FILE}" ]; then
rm "${CERT_DIR}/${CERT_FILE}"
echo -e "[O] Removed: ${CERT_DIR}/${CERT_FILE}"
fi
if [ -f "${CERT_DIR}/${KEY_FILE}" ]; then
rm "${CERT_DIR}/${KEY_FILE}"
echo -e "[O] Removed: ${CERT_DIR}/${KEY_FILE}"
fi
# Remove SSL listener config
SSL_LISTENER="/usr/local/lsws/conf/cert/${DOMAIN}.xml"
docker compose exec ${CONT_NAME} bash -c "[ -f ${SSL_LISTENER} ] && rm ${SSL_LISTENER}"
echo '[End] Removing SSL certificate'
lsws_restart
}
main(){
if [ "${INSTALL}" = 'true' ]; then
install_mkcert
exit 0
fi
if [ "${REMOVE}" = 'true' ]; then
remove_cert
exit 0
fi
check_mkcert
generate_cert
configure_litespeed
echo ""
echo -e "\033[1m[SUCCESS] SSL certificate setup completed!\033[0m"
echo ""
echo "Next steps:"
echo "1. Add '${DOMAIN}' to your Windows hosts file (C:\Windows\System32\drivers\etc\hosts)"
echo " Example: 127.0.0.1 ${DOMAIN} ${WWW_DOMAIN}"
echo "2. Configure your virtual host to use SSL-${DOMAIN} listener"
echo "3. Access https://${DOMAIN} in your browser"
}
check_input ${1}
while [ ! -z "${1}" ]; do
case ${1} in
-[hH] | -help | --help)
help_message
;;
-[dD] | -domain | --domain)
shift
check_input "${1}"
DOMAIN="${1}"
;;
-[iI] | --install)
INSTALL=true
;;
-[rR] | --remove)
REMOVE=true
;;
*)
help_message
;;
esac
shift
done
main
